Имя: Пароль:
1C
1С v8
Помогите с внешним отчетом
0 Fire-Rex
 
19.11.14
10:51
Добрый день! Поставили задачу написать внешний отчет по продажам в 1с БП 8.2 в разрезе ответственных, контрагентов и номенклатуры. Сделал. Из реализации заказчик перешел в регистр хозрасчетный и вручную убрал количество и сумму. Понятно, что мой отчет это не обработал. Делай, говорит, по регистру, что бы и это учитывал. Подскажите, как связать этот регистр с реализацией?
1 Fire-Rex
 
19.11.14
10:51
Или может я не туда думаю?
2 Ёпрст
 
19.11.14
10:52
А куда думаешь, о метле ваши мысли ?
3 Ёпрст
 
19.11.14
10:53
Нам отсюда не видно, из каких данных строится ваш отчет и какое отношение регистр хозрасчетный к этому имеет.
4 pessok
 
19.11.14
10:53
(0) яничегонепонял.пнг

дебет 62 счета?
ответственный будет Регистратор.Ответственный
5 butterbean
 
19.11.14
10:53
(0) нужно сразу было делать по регистрам, если не значешь счетов учета — спроси у бухгалтера
6 Fire-Rex
 
19.11.14
10:53
Сделать, что-то типа, если вручную исправлены - брать оттуда, если нет - тянуть из реализации
7 Fire-Rex
 
19.11.14
10:54
Ок, подскажите по каким регистрам
8 butterbean
 
19.11.14
10:54
(7) регистр бухгалтерии "Хозрасчетный"
9 pessok
 
19.11.14
10:58
(0) ты на собеседовании сидишь, чтоль? :) что тебе ЗАКАЗЧИК говорит, как надо данные для отчета брать? :)
10 DmitriyDI
 
19.11.14
11:03
(9) говорит зайди и спроси на мисту)
11 pessok
 
19.11.14
11:03
(10) та не, он сначала сказал, что надо брать данные из регистров. а потом уже про мисту сказал, услышав "а из какого регистра?" :D
12 DmitriyDI
 
19.11.14
11:04
(0) заходишь в реализацию, смотришь проводки документ, какие дает, и по какому регистру, думаешь, и понеслась!
13 Fire-Rex
 
19.11.14
11:06
Шуткуете, блин)
14 butterbean
 
19.11.14
11:08
(13) Вообще я уверен, что тебе дали изначально нерешаемую корректно задачу, т.к. получить из бух проводок сумму продажи в разрезе номенклатуры невозможно. Бухгалтерия как бы не для этого. Тем более можно вводить проводки вручную вообще без документов реализации.
15 Fire-Rex
 
19.11.14
11:11
(14) Вот и я думаю...
16 Fire-Rex
 
19.11.14
11:12
Не судите новичка уж строго
17 pessok
 
19.11.14
11:14
(14) однозначно прав
18 Fire-Rex
 
19.11.14
11:23
А Связать возможно запись из регистра с реализацией?
19 Oleg_ka
 
19.11.14
11:25
(18) Можно связать с типом документа.
ГДЕ
    ХозрасчетныйОстаткиИОбороты.Регистратор ССЫЛКА Документ.РеализацияТоваровУслуг
20 pessok
 
19.11.14
11:28
+(19) только не забудь, что тебе тогда либо надо менять периодичность виртуальной таблицы, либо брать из физической, за что бьют линейкой по пальцам
21 Fire-Rex
 
19.11.14
11:31
(20) Почему некорректно брать из физ.таблицы?
22 butterbean
 
19.11.14
11:38
(21) потому что твой "заказчик" возьмет ОСВ, сравнит с твоим отчетом и скажет что не сходится и нужно опять переделывать :-)
23 pessok
 
19.11.14
11:38
(21) методология такая
24 Fire-Rex
 
19.11.14
11:44
В целом задача была такая: нужен отчет по эффективности работы менеджеров по схеме менеджер-->контрагент-->реализация-->номенклатура. Не долго думая сделал по реализации. Но товарищ "заказюк" перешел в проводки и ручками поправил. Некорректный, говорит, отчет. Вот я и повис
25 Fire-Rex
 
19.11.14
11:45
Полез в хозрасчетный, нашел только ссылку на документ реализация
26 butterbean
 
19.11.14
11:45
(24) спроси его с каких проводок конкретно какие данные (сумму, количество) собирать
27 Fire-Rex
 
19.11.14
11:46
Сказал с отбором по счету.
28 Fire-Rex
 
19.11.14
11:47
Нужны количество и сумма
29 pessok
 
19.11.14
11:47
(24) 90.01.1 строится по номенклатурным группам, так что никак
делай свой регистр накопления Продажи, подпиской на события "ПриПроведенииДокумента" для реализации пиши в него данные
30 butterbean
 
19.11.14
11:47
(27) по какому счету
(28) сумма продажи или какая??
31 pessok
 
19.11.14
11:48
(27) по какому счету, блин?
32 Oleg_ka
 
19.11.14
11:50
Сейчас меня, конечно же, закидают...но
ВЫБРАТЬ
    ХозрасчетныйДвиженияССубконто.Регистратор.Ответственный,
    ХозрасчетныйДвиженияССубконто.Регистратор,
    ХозрасчетныйДвиженияССубконто.СубконтоДт1 КАК Контрагент,
    ХозрасчетныйДвиженияССубконто.СубконтоКт3 КАК Номенклатура,
    ХозрасчетныйДвиженияССубконто.Сумма,
    ХозрасчетныйДвиженияССубконто.КоличествоКт
ИЗ
    РегистрБухгалтерии.Хозрасчетный.ДвиженияССубконто(
            ,
            ,
            СчетДт В ИЕРАРХИИ (&Счет62)
                И СчетКТ В ИЕРАРХИИ (&Счет90),
            ,
            ) КАК ХозрасчетныйДвиженияССубконто
33 pessok
 
19.11.14
11:57
на 90 и 62 нет субконто "Номенклатура"
34 pessok
 
19.11.14
12:00
вру, третье субконто номенклатура, ога
35 Мимохожий Однако
 
19.11.14
12:04
В сложных ситуациях я прошу Заказчика дать пример для нескольких строк отчета. Откуда берет, где видит промежуточные результаты и т.д. Если отчет собирается вручную, то останется только посмотреть где лежат промежуточные данные и сваять отчет. В данном случае сабж начался с хвоста. Результат как обычно непредсказуем
36 Fire-Rex
 
19.11.14
12:23
Ребят, спасибо огромное за советы!
37 Fire-Rex
 
19.11.14
12:24
Oleg_ka ОГРОМНОЕ спасибо!